Senate Bill 97 proposes amendments to the Tennessee Code Annotated regarding the Tennessee monuments and memorials commission. Specifically, it deletes subdivision (51) from Section 4-29-246(a) and introduces a new subdivision in Section 4-29-250(a) that formally recognizes the Tennessee monuments and memorials commission, which is established by Section 4-1-412.
The bill aims to streamline the legal framework surrounding the commission by removing outdated provisions and ensuring that the commission is explicitly mentioned in the relevant statutes. This legislation is set to take effect immediately upon becoming law, emphasizing the importance of the public welfare in its enactment.
Statutes affected: Introduced: 4-29-246(a), 4-29-246, 4-29-250(a), 4-29-250
